The Power of Meetings
April 01, 2009The professional meetings industry is under attack on many fronts. Many organizations have cut back on meeting expenditures due to declining attendance and revenues, but even more alarming is the political backlash the meetings industry is facing because of a few ill-advised and well-publicized meetings held by firms that received federal TARP funds.
Those of us in the industry all know the real value of meetings. From face-to-face interaction with our colleagues to educational and networking opportunities, meetings are at the core of America’s business. As speaker and economist Ben Stein recently wrote in the New York Times, “Meetings are not the enemy. In terms of making the nation more productive and better off, they are builders, not saboteurs.”
